Is Cinci Bell really the only option? I am right on the CBD/OTR area and apparently cannnot get fiberoptics so all I have is the 5mbps option, which is literally brutal. Streaming is beyond painful, downloading is miserable.

How are you guys coping with this? What have you done about it? How the companies that work in CBD survive?

CB Fiberoptics is relatively new to the area, so it does not surprise me they do not have the service available everywhere. I have CB Fiberoptics and frankly am not thrilled with the speed. I could probably get faster by giving them more money, but that is not what I thought I was sold.

Have you contacted Time Warner? Since they have been around for umpteen years I would think they have most of downtown covered. I had them for years and years and wish I had them back. If CB tries to up my monthly rate again I probably will get TW back.

I saw that they installed the fiber lines on my street a few months ago. I was only able to get only the lowest version of the fiberoptic. 10 mbps. I ended up just getting the time warner ultimate 50 mbps down 5 mbps up for $79. It's the fastest speed I ever had. That price did not require a bundle and after a year it goes up about $5 or so.
